China News Service, August 19th. The "National Development and Reform Commission" public account published an article on the 19th to interpret the problem of excessive packaging of boxed mooncakes.

  Previously, the National Development and Reform Commission, the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ology, the Ministry of Commerce, and the State Administration for Market Regulation issued the "Announcement on Curbing "Sky-High" Mooncakes and Promoting the Healthy Development of the Industry" (hereinafter referred to as the "Announcement"), emphasizing that online merchants sell boxed Mooncakes should abide by the same regulatory requirements as offline merchants.

  The article pointed out that with the development of the Internet economy, the number of mooncakes sold through online channels such as e-commerce platforms has increased year by year, accounting for more than 30%.

Due to the variety of online sales forms and the low transparency of sales behavior, it is an area with a high probability of "high-priced" mooncakes in recent years.

Online merchants selling mooncakes not only have problems such as adding expensive fillings, excessively luxurious packaging, and tying high-priced products, but also have problems such as falsely marking the price of mooncakes, increasing prices in disguised form, and providing "high-priced" mooncake customization services.

For example, some are priced at 299 yuan per box, but the remark is "make two boxes and send one box", and the actual price per box is 598 yuan; some are priced at 499 yuan, and ask to make up the difference of 200 yuan; some are not only priced at 499 yuan, but also A high express delivery fee of 600 yuan is set up; some provide various types of luxury packaging according to customer needs, combine moon cakes with designated high-priced commodities, and issue invoices in the name of moon cakes, which facilitates customization of "sky-high" moon cakes.

  The "Announcement" makes targeted regulations on online merchants' sales behavior: it is not allowed to falsely bid the price of goods or increase the price in a disguised form by splitting orders, falsely increasing the quantity of goods, etc.; National mandatory standards, etc.

Relevant departments regard online sales as a key supervision area, strengthen supervision, and strictly investigate and deal with according to laws and regulations, and typical cases will be exposed.

  The "Announcement" also requires e-commerce platforms to implement the main responsibility for the supervision of online merchants, focusing on supervising online merchants selling boxed mooncakes with a unit price of more than 500 yuan and providing customized services, prohibiting violations of food safety, restricting excessive packaging and other mandatory standards. of merchants are engaged in mooncake sales activities on the platform.
